Anyone have or hear of my problem:
2tb esata drive on a 7232. At first FF and Rew worked fine. As drive fills up (40%), and when your are recording a program but watching another all speeds (2x,4x,8x) stop working correctly for FF and Rew. You press the FF or rew button, the power led button blinks, but the program does not stop. The command is ignored or very very delayed. Even pressing button several times has no effect. If nothing is being recorded, the FF and Rew work fine. If watching a program on internal drive, while recording on external, no problem. I have many programs on the external drive. Maybe a memory issue Looking for a fix before I have to send drive back.
external drive is a seagate pipeline for av. I have tried the drive on two different external cases.

To try to fix the FF/RW problem, press menu, then go to CUSTOMER SUPPORT, then IN HOME AGENT, then SET TOP BOX AUTO CORRECTION. Before sending the drive back, try one last test by plugging it into another DVR (doing so you will lose your recordings which is why I say do it as a last resort before sending drive back)
Thanks for reply Anthony. I actually got tech support involved and did what you suggested. He also sent some codes (that reset some things), but still no good. Talked to his supervisor and he came to conclusion that it is probably due to the 7232 limit memory and processor speed with the extra large drive. Recommended to go with 1tb drive I do have a 1tb external on other 7232 that does not seem to show same problem.
